Inclusion Criteria | |
 1) Diagnosis of advanced non-small cell lung cancer or inoperable pancreatic cancer | |
 2) Scheduled for systemic cancer therapy (i.e. chemotherapy, and/or targeted therapy and/or immunotherapy) | |
  i. In pancreatic cancer patients, planned systemic chemotherapy only allows of the combination of gemcitabine with nanoparticle paclitaxel. | |
 3) Eastern Cooperative Oncology Group (ECOG) performance status 0 to 2 | |
 4) Age ≥ 70 years | |
 5) Body weight of 6 month ago can be confirmed | |
 6) An expected survival of ≥3 months as judged by investigators | |
 7) Written informed consent | |
 8) Adequate organ function | |
  i. Hemoglobin ≥8.0 g/dl | |
  ii. Total bilirubin ≤2.0 mg/dl | |
  iii. Aspartate aminotransferase ≤150 IU/L | |
  iv. Alanine aminotransferase ≤150 IU/L | |
  v. Serum creatinine ≤2.0 mg/dl | |
  vi. Arterial oxygen saturation (SpO2) ≥ 90% or partial pressure of oxygen in arterial blood (PaO2) ≥ 60 Torr in room air | |
  vii. Resting heart rate < 120 beat per minute | |
Exclusion criteria | |
 1) Patients received prior chemotherapy except adjuvant chemotherapy | |
 2) Active malignancy requiring cancer treatment including chemotherapy, radiotherapy and surgery within 3 months | |
 3) Patients who need nursing care at following situation (based on Katz Index) | |
  i. Bathing | |
  ii. Dressing | |
  iii. Transferring | |
  iv. Feeding | |
 4) Symptomatic brain metastasis or leptomeningeal carcinoma | |
 5) Bone metastasis with high risk of fracture | |
 6) Patients who are difficult to evaluate or intervene with cardiovascular disease, bone and joint disease, neuromuscular disease etc. | |
 7) Patients who are difficult to participant due to psychiatric disorder | |
 8) Patients who are difficult to oral intake | |
 9) History of acute myocardial infarction, unstable angina, uncontrollable hypertension, and symptomatic sustained arrhythmia within 6 months. Stable atrial fibrillation treated with appropriate anticoagulation therapy is allowed. | |
 10) Uncontrollable diabetes mellitus | |
 11) Patients whose appropriate period has not passed since prior treatment | |
  i. Surgery: 7 days | |
  ii. Palliative radiation: 1 day | |
  iii. Minor surgery (i.e. biopsy): 1 day | |
 12) Screening failure | |
  i. Patients who failed to wear the accelerometer for more than 4 days | |
  ii. Patients who could not properly handle the accelerometer | |
  iii. Patients who failed to initiate first-line therapy within 14 days of enrollment |
